Ordinals
beta
Sat 1295143838700816
decimal
308057.1338700816
degree
0°98057′1625″1338700816‴
percentile
61.67351619645118%
name
erfdnputblp
cycle
0
epoch
1
period
152
block
308057
offset
1338700816
timestamp
2014-06-27 05:34:01 UTC
rarity
common
prev
next